Replacement toyota remote/key combo.
Aug 7, 2013, 9:19 AM
|
|
a brief effort shows a very wide range in price, from like $25 for a used one, which would require a new key, to $230 for a new one from a local locksmith. Not sure if it has to be programmed, that's $30.
Anybody ever bought one o these? It's for an '08 Rav4. Only came with one.
